Position Summary

Location: The Old Station Nursery Houlton, Dollman Farm, Houlton, Rugby, Warwickshire, CV23 1AL

Full‑time 38‑42 hours over 4 days per week, shifts from 7.30am‑5.30pm or 8am‑6pm.

Pay: £31,844 per annum (based on experience, 40 hours per week).

Qualifications

You must hold a Level 3 Early Years qualification or Qualified Teacher Status (QTS).

About Our Nursery

The nursery in Rugby is a carefully planned, purpose‑built nursery which offers a stimulating and engaging learning environment for our community’s children. It was opened at the end of 2021, is light and airy even on cloudy days, and we are fortunate to have an allotment space for the children to develop a lifelong love and understanding of sustainable planting and growing. It is in close proximity to Houlton Play Park and the new Co‑op, with easy access to the main Crick Road and a car park right next door.

Responsibilities

As a Nursery Room Leader, you will work alongside the Nursery Manager to lead and inspire your team while delivering exceptional care and education. Your key responsibilities include:

  • Leading and mentoring the team to provide high‑quality early years education with passion and energy.
  • Supporting the Nursery Manager to ensure smooth nursery operations and consistent quality.
  • Acting as a role model by promoting initiative, creativity, and high standards of care.
  • Building strong relationships with families, colleagues, and external agencies to support the best outcomes for children.
  • Overseeing the team’s implementation of the EYFS framework, ensuring engaging learning opportunities.
  • Taking charge of nursery operations in the Nursery Manager’s absence.
  • Encouraging continuous improvement through feedback and supporting professional development.
  • Maintaining a safe, inclusive, and stimulating environment that meets each child’s needs.

How to prepare for a job interview at The Old Station Nursery Group

Know Your Stuff

Make sure you’re well-versed in the EYFS framework and can discuss how you’ve implemented it in previous roles. Brush up on your Level 3 Early Years qualification or QTS knowledge, as they’ll likely ask you about your qualifications and how they relate to the position.

Show Your Leadership Skills

As a Nursery Room Leader, you’ll need to inspire your team. Prepare examples of how you’ve led a team in the past, highlighting your mentoring style and how you promote creativity and high standards. Think about specific situations where you’ve made a positive impact.

Build Relationships

Demonstrate your ability to build strong relationships with families and colleagues. Be ready to share examples of how you’ve engaged with parents or worked collaboratively with your team to support children’s development. This shows you understand the importance of community in a nursery setting.

Ask Thoughtful Questions

Prepare some insightful questions to ask at the end of your interview. This could be about the nursery’s approach to professional development or how they foster a stimulating environment for children. It shows your genuine interest in the role and helps you assess if it’s the right fit for you.
